Output 84c1c10b1c97d64f0d522fc239b419af57b6fef4cdee94f846c19f3a277eb148:1

value
10694188
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23c4f082cb2f68d382749fffacfc8bbe49777c94 OP_EQUAL
address
34x9VrUgXQVTeDzQBeBdX2NFakuiW7mnkG
transaction
84c1c10b1c97d64f0d522fc239b419af57b6fef4cdee94f846c19f3a277eb148
confirmations
374152
spent
true